    <h4><strong>UMBC Transitioning to RCA Stage 4 on June 1</strong></h4>
    <ul><li>
    <span>UMBC will transition to Stage 4 on-campus Research and Creative Achievement mode on June 1. Under Stage 4, we require a minimum of 50 sq.ft. per individual in any laboratory or studio on campus, an adjustment from the prior density of 150 sq.ft. per person under Stage 3, leading to an increase in density in labs and studios. </span><span>More details are available </span><a href="https://research.umbc.edu/research-and-creative-achievement-at-umbc-during-covid-19/" rel="nofollow external" class="bo">here</a><span>.</span>
    </li></ul>
    <h4><strong>Updated Domestic Travel Guidance</strong></h4>
    <ul><li>
    <span>University-related domestic business travel for faculty, staff, and students will resume on June 1, 2021. The University will reinstate pre-pandemic approval policies, including the requirement that all out-of-state and overnight in-state travel be approved prior to making any travel arrangements. Learn more </span><a href="https://my3.my.umbc.edu/groups/insights/posts/101976" rel="nofollow external" class="bo">here</a><span>.</span>

<Title>REMINDER: Vaccine appointments</Title>
<Body>
<![CDATA[
    <div class="html-content"><span><p><span>Dear Students,</span></p>
    <br><p><span>We still have a limited number of appointments available for UMBC’s first on-campus COVID-19 Vaccination Clinic. We will be offering the Pfizer vaccine on </span><span>Tuesday, May 11 from 9 AM - 1 PM, </span><span>please</span><span>sign-up </span><a href="https://kordinator.mhealthcoach.net/vcl/UMBCDose1" rel="nofollow external" class="bo"><span>here</span></a><span> for the first dose. We will offer second shots on campus on Tuesday, June 1, 9AM - 1 PM. You can sign-up to receive your second dose on campus </span><a href="https://kordinator.mhealthcoach.net/vcl/UMBCDose2" rel="nofollow external" class="bo"><span>here</span></a><span>. </span></p>
    <br><p><span>We are also offering the single dose Johnson &amp; Johnson vaccine on </span><span>Wednesday, May 12 from 9 AM - 12 noon. </span><span>Sign-up </span><a href="https://kordinator.mhealthcoach.net/vcl/UMBC" rel="nofollow external" class="bo"><span>here</span></a><span> for the Johnson &amp; Johnson vaccine clinic. </span></p>
    <br><p><span>Both clinics will be in the UC Ballroom, when you arrive on campus, please park in </span><a href="https://about.umbc.edu/files/2019/12/2019-2020-general-campus-map.pdf" rel="nofollow external" class="bo"><span>Lot 8</span></a><span>. You must wear a mask and practice physical distancing. </span></p>
    <br><p><span>We know that these dates overlap with the end of the semester and that some students may be concerned about vaccine reactions. While reactions to the first shot are typically mild, you are welcome to wait and </span><a href="https://covid19.umbc.edu/vaccine-information-resources/" rel="nofollow external" class="bo"><span>seek vaccination</span></a><span> off-campus at a later time. We also plan to offer additional clinics on campus throughout the summer. Remember that you are fully vaccinated </span><span>2 weeks after</span><span> your last vaccine dose, so plan enough time after your second shot before you return to campus in the fall.</span></p>
